Action item from the Tarwold catalog incident: invalidation messages lagged behind price updates, so customers saw stale listings for up to an hour. We are moving to versioned cache keys with a short grace window, and support should expect transient mismatch reports during rollout. After load testing on the Quade cluster, we settled on these constants.

tuning table, yajog-yahof:
BUDGETS = {
    "lamvan": 303,
    "wenox": 460,
    "fenvan": 525,
}

Handover: Paygrove integration tests

Handing this to you before my rotation ends. The Paygrove settlement suite flakes on roughly one in eight CI runs — always the refund-reversal cases, always a timeout against the mock ledger. I've narrowed it to the fixture teardown racing the ledger's async flush; a 200ms settle wait masks it but isn't a fix. My draft patch serializes teardown properly — please review that branch. The sealed test-ledger snapshot unlocks with the recovery passphrase below.

strongbox words: sorir-belvan-rusix-ulays-ralmir-praix-eliir-tamax-praael-druael-julir-tamius-jorir

**Vendor note: Inkmill markdown pipeline**

Rendering for Parchway docs is outsourced to Inkmill under an annual contract, renewing each March. They handle sanitization and PDF export; we own the upload queue. SLA: 4-hour response on rendering failures. Escalate only after two failed retries. Their support desk is reachable at the address below.

billing contact of hahaf-baguf = zorael.tammir.jorius@sivrelhq.internal